Output 26bc9623f9e162dd80eb5a177cba1e07e22729d5e798b70d6345c9586bfe6e24:1

value
84768220
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2fb11092736e63195833b26a917c2b3039001b09 OP_EQUALVERIFY OP_CHECKSIG
address
15MAsgzPkLJNTEae4cREnBpEegfZp7Lncq
transaction
26bc9623f9e162dd80eb5a177cba1e07e22729d5e798b70d6345c9586bfe6e24
confirmations
579259
spent
true